How Abiways Tablet works:

Abiways tablets contain acebrophylline and acetylcysteine, two medications that work together to improve breathing. Acebrophylline acts as both a bronchodilator, relaxing airway muscles, and a mucolytic, thinning and loosening mucus. This dual action facilitates easier breathing. Acetylcysteine, also a mucolytic agent, further assists in thinning phlegm, promoting more effective cough expulsion.

FAQs on Abiways Tablet

Abiways Tablet contains acetylcysteine, which can affect certain lab tests, such as urine ketone tests, potentially leading to inaccurate results. Please tell your doctor you're taking Abiways Tablet before any testing.
Increasing this medication's dosage won't enhance its effectiveness; it may only worsen side effects. If your symptoms persist despite taking the prescribed amount, consult your doctor for reassessment.
Store this medication in its original, tightly sealed container, as directed on the packaging. Discard any unused medication. Keep out of reach of children, pets, and others.
